The March. 11, 2005 Emory Wheel (student paper at Emory) reports: Law alumna elected state chief justice By Rachel Zelkowitz Asst. News Editor March 11, 2005 An Emory School of Law alumna was elected chief justice of the Georgia Supreme Court on March 2, and is now preparing to take office as the state’s final arbiter. The alumna, Georgia Associate Justice Leah Ward Sears (’80L), will become the first female chief justice and the second black chief justice in state history when she replaces current Chief Justice Norman Fletcher on July 1. Justice Sears' official biography on the Georgia Supreme Court web site states that she is a member of Alpha Kappa Alpha. See: http://www2.state.ga.us/Courts/Supre...ios.html#sears |
